Bitcoin (BTC) versus Bitcoin Cash (BCH) is one of the most antagonistic conflicts that is currently happening in digital currencies. The teams behind each network have massively diverse visions for what the future of the Bitcoin blockchain should be. Although the skirmish originally arose over apprehensions concerning block size, the conflict expanded to include many issues such as censorship, business ethics, decentralization and many facets.

I would hardly call it a civil war. BCH is a minor coin. It has 30x less marketcap and 30x less volume than bitcoin. What's more, as bitcoin's daily volume has been steadily increasing for the past month, BCH's hasn't really moved from where it was a month ago. Looking long term, all BCH has done since it was forked is slowly lose value against bitcoin, peaking around 0.2 during the height of its pump-and-dump phase shortly after creation, and now sitting down around 0.03.
